Hi there.

I will be flying to Noosa from Perth on 16th March, and staying untill 1st April.
I was wondering how the wind is this time of year, and how many kiteable days I can expect on average?
Also what kind of wind strengths can I expect?

Winds that time of year are predominatly SE but in answer to the rest of your question - how long is a piece of string?

Best advice is to keep an eye on the forecasts and phone Fiona or Gerge at Adventure Sports here in noosa on (07) 5455 6677 cloer to your mark.

You will need to travel to get the SE winds even if going to Sunshine Sunrise for a beach sesson so a hire car is on the list of priorities.
